More patients discharged as COVID-19 cases rise to 288

Fourteen new cases of COVID-19 have been reported in Nigeria: 13 in Lagos and one in Delta State.

As at 09:30 pm 9th April there are 288 confirmed cases of COVID-19 reported in Nigeria. Fifty-one have been discharged with seven deaths.

A breakdown shows

Lagos- 158
FCT- 54
Osun- 20
Edo- 12
Oyo- 11
Bauchi- 6
Akwa Ibom- 5
Ogun- 4
Kaduna- 5
Enugu- 2
Ekiti- 2
Rivers-2
Kwara- 2
Delta- 2
Benue- 1
Ondo- 1
Katsina-1
